Rats and mice are common concerns for both homeowners and businesses. Rodents can enter through small gaps around doors, pipes, drains, roofs, and walls. Once inside, they can hide behind appliances, under floors, inside cupboards, and within wall cavities. They may contaminate food, leave droppings, damage insulation, and chew electrical wiring.
Professional rodent management can help control existing activity while identifying possible entry points. Property owners can then improve food storage, waste management, cleanliness, and proofing to reduce the risk of future infestations.

Cockroaches can be difficult to eliminate because they often hide in warm, dark, and sheltered locations. Kitchens, cupboards, appliances, drains, and plumbing areas can all provide suitable harbourages. Once established, cockroach populations can increase quickly. Professional pest treatment can help identify affected areas and apply suitable control measures.
Bed bugs are another challenging infestation. They can hide in mattresses, bed frames, furniture, carpets, cracks, and other concealed spaces. Because they are small and often active at night, property owners may not immediately recognise an infestation. Wasps can become particularly troublesome when nests are located near doors, windows, gardens, roof spaces, lofts, garages, or sheds. Disturbing a nest without appropriate precautions can increase the risk of stings. Professional treatment can help manage wasp activity and reduce risks around occupied areas.
Ants can also become persistent when colonies establish themselves inside or close to a property. Seeing a small number of ants does not always mean the problem is limited. Ant trails may lead towards food sources or nesting locations. Professional pest management can help address the infestation while identifying conditions that may be attracting ants.
Common Signs of Pest Infestation
Recognising signs of pest activity early can make treatment easier and help prevent infestations from spreading.
Rats and mice: Look for droppings, gnaw marks, scratching noises, damaged packaging, nesting materials, and unusual smells.
Cockroaches: Live or dead insects, droppings, egg cases, shed skins, and unpleasant odours may indicate an infestation.
Bed bugs: Dark marks on bedding, blood spots, shed skins, bites, and visible insects can be possible signs of bed bugs.
Wasps: Increased wasp activity around one particular location may suggest that a nest is nearby.
Ants: Repeated trails of ants inside kitchens, rooms, or commercial premises may indicate a nearby colony.
Fleas: Fleas can live in carpets, rugs, upholstery, and pet resting areas. Persistent bites or pet scratching may warrant investigation.
Moths: Holes and damage in clothing, carpets, fabrics, and stored materials can indicate moth activity.

Preventing Future Pest Problems
Pest control should not only focus on removing existing pests. Prevention is equally important. Property owners can reduce the risk of infestations by keeping food in sealed containers, removing rubbish regularly, cleaning spills promptly, and maintaining good housekeeping standards.
Gaps around doors, windows, pipes, walls, drains, and roofs should be checked where appropriate. Damaged seals and potential entry points should be repaired to make it harder for rodents and insects to enter.
Commercial premises should pay particular attention to kitchens, stockrooms, delivery areas, waste storage, drains, and food storage spaces. Regular inspections can help identify early warning signs before an infestation becomes more serious.
Reducing clutter can also remove hiding places for pests. Keeping gardens and outdoor areas tidy may further reduce opportunities for pests to establish themselves around buildings.
